Everyone can learn and be successful if given the right motivation, learning strategies and tools. My classroom is set up to allow teaching whole group, small groups or working one on one. My biggest challenges are to help them reach their full potential and be able to express themselves clearly.
I have 14 4th-6th grade students in my Special Day class who have autism, learning disabilities and/or are intellectually challenged.
Although the class has three different grades, my students' ability levels vary quite a bit. I have a non-reader student to students who can read fluently, but have trouble comprehending what they read. Almost all my students can write a simple paragraph with help and guidance. My students are thrilled when they get to use the computer lab to work on different reading, vocabulary and math programs. They are more motivated to read and write when they can use a computer, laptop or iPad in the classroom.
Our school has over 700 students. The teachers welcome my students into their classroom.
